Design and biological evaluation of biphenyl-4-carboxylic acid hydrazide-hydrazone for antimicrobial activity
Deep, Aakash,Jain, Sandeep,Sharma, Prabodh Chander,Verma, Prabhakar,Kumar, Mahesh,Dora, Chander Parkash
, p. 255 - 259 (2011/07/08)
Seven biphenyl-4-carboxylic acid hydrazide-hydrazones have been synthesized. These hydrazone derivatives were characterized by CHN analysis, IR, and 1H NMR spectral data. All the compounds were evaluated for their in vitro antimicrobial activity against two Gram negative strains (Escherichia coli and Pseudomonas aeruginosa) and two Gram positive strains (Bacillus subtilis and Staphylococcus aureus) and fungal strain Candida albicans and Aspergillus niger. All newly synthesized compounds exhibited promising results.
